Is wearing Trousers sinful?
Deuteronomy 22:5 – A WOMAN MUST NOT WEAR MEN’S CLOTHING, nor a man wear women’s clothing, for the Lord your God detests (hates) anyone who does this.
There's no mention of 'skirts' or 'trousers' in that verse - Deut 22:5. The substance of that injunction is that men and women should not confuse their gender appearances; and the motive is to discourage the lifestyles that may stem from such practices. Confusion of appearances lead to confusion of gender roles. Such lifestyles may include homosexual tendencies among God's people, which is another abomination (Lev.20:13); or gender roles confused altogether, in the family and society at large.
It is interesting that the dress-sense and fashion of the Old Testament people included the idea that men and women wore garments that had skirts. Notice the masculine pronouns used in Psa. 133:2 - "It is like the precious ointment upon the head, that ran down upon the beard, even Aaron's beard: that went down to the skirts of his garments" and of Ezekiel: "Thou shalt also take thereof a few in number, and bind them in thy skirts" (Ezek. 5:3). So men wore garments that had skirts back then, but not in the sense of 'skirts' (a woman's garment which hangs down from the waist) as we understand them today. The skirts of Aaron's garment were simply in reference to the outer border of the priestly garments.
Deut. 22:5 is NOT condemning women wearing trousers. The substance and motive for that verse is to discourage any confusion of gender identity and roles among people professing to belong to God. It was given to emphasize distinction between men and women. It didn't specify which kind of clothes, just what pertains to men and women. Who now decides what pertains to men?
There are men trousers and women trousers. Equally, there are men shirts and women shirts. If we assume that Deut 22:5 is condemning women wearing trouser in that it belongs to men, then what of shirts? Who does it belong to?
